C# Класс iTextSharp.text.pdf.PdfShading

Показать файл Открыть проект Примеры использования класса

Защищенные свойства (Protected)

Свойство Тип Описание
antiAlias bool
bBox float[]
colorDetails ColorDetails
shading PdfDictionary
shadingName PdfName
shadingReference PdfIndirectReference
shadingType int
writer PdfWriter

Private Properties

Свойство Тип Описание

Открытые методы

Метод Описание
AddToBody ( ) : void
CheckCompatibleColors ( BaseColor c1, BaseColor c2 ) : void
GetColorArray ( BaseColor color ) : float[]
SimpleAxial ( PdfWriter writer, float x0, float y0, float x1, float y1, BaseColor startColor, BaseColor endColor ) : PdfShading
SimpleAxial ( PdfWriter writer, float x0, float y0, float x1, float y1, BaseColor startColor, BaseColor endColor, bool extendStart, bool extendEnd ) : PdfShading
SimpleRadial ( PdfWriter writer, float x0, float y0, float r0, float x1, float y1, float r1, BaseColor startColor, BaseColor endColor ) : PdfShading
SimpleRadial ( PdfWriter writer, float x0, float y0, float r0, float x1, float y1, float r1, BaseColor startColor, BaseColor endColor, bool extendStart, bool extendEnd ) : PdfShading
ThrowColorSpaceError ( ) : void
Type1 ( PdfWriter writer, BaseColor colorSpace, float domain, float tMatrix, PdfFunction function ) : PdfShading
Type2 ( PdfWriter writer, BaseColor colorSpace, float coords, float domain, PdfFunction function, bool extend ) : PdfShading
Type3 ( PdfWriter writer, BaseColor colorSpace, float coords, float domain, PdfFunction function, bool extend ) : PdfShading

Защищенные методы

Метод Описание
PdfShading ( PdfWriter writer ) : System
SetColorSpace ( BaseColor color ) : void

Описание методов

AddToBody() публичный метод

public AddToBody ( ) : void
Результат void

CheckCompatibleColors() публичный статический метод

public static CheckCompatibleColors ( BaseColor c1, BaseColor c2 ) : void
c1 iTextSharp.text.BaseColor
c2 iTextSharp.text.BaseColor
Результат void

GetColorArray() публичный статический метод

public static GetColorArray ( BaseColor color ) : float[]
color iTextSharp.text.BaseColor
Результат float[]

PdfShading() защищенный метод

protected PdfShading ( PdfWriter writer ) : System
writer PdfWriter
Результат System

SetColorSpace() защищенный метод

protected SetColorSpace ( BaseColor color ) : void
color iTextSharp.text.BaseColor
Результат void

SimpleAxial() публичный статический метод

public static SimpleAxial ( PdfWriter writer, float x0, float y0, float x1, float y1, BaseColor startColor, BaseColor endColor ) : PdfShading
writer PdfWriter
x0 float
y0 float
x1 float
y1 float
startColor iTextSharp.text.BaseColor
endColor iTextSharp.text.BaseColor
Результат PdfShading

SimpleAxial() публичный статический метод

public static SimpleAxial ( PdfWriter writer, float x0, float y0, float x1, float y1, BaseColor startColor, BaseColor endColor, bool extendStart, bool extendEnd ) : PdfShading
writer PdfWriter
x0 float
y0 float
x1 float
y1 float
startColor iTextSharp.text.BaseColor
endColor iTextSharp.text.BaseColor
extendStart bool
extendEnd bool
Результат PdfShading

SimpleRadial() публичный статический метод

public static SimpleRadial ( PdfWriter writer, float x0, float y0, float r0, float x1, float y1, float r1, BaseColor startColor, BaseColor endColor ) : PdfShading
writer PdfWriter
x0 float
y0 float
r0 float
x1 float
y1 float
r1 float
startColor iTextSharp.text.BaseColor
endColor iTextSharp.text.BaseColor
Результат PdfShading

SimpleRadial() публичный статический метод

public static SimpleRadial ( PdfWriter writer, float x0, float y0, float r0, float x1, float y1, float r1, BaseColor startColor, BaseColor endColor, bool extendStart, bool extendEnd ) : PdfShading
writer PdfWriter
x0 float
y0 float
r0 float
x1 float
y1 float
r1 float
startColor iTextSharp.text.BaseColor
endColor iTextSharp.text.BaseColor
extendStart bool
extendEnd bool
Результат PdfShading

ThrowColorSpaceError() публичный статический метод

public static ThrowColorSpaceError ( ) : void
Результат void

Type1() публичный статический метод

public static Type1 ( PdfWriter writer, BaseColor colorSpace, float domain, float tMatrix, PdfFunction function ) : PdfShading
writer PdfWriter
colorSpace iTextSharp.text.BaseColor
domain float
tMatrix float
function PdfFunction
Результат PdfShading

Type2() публичный статический метод

public static Type2 ( PdfWriter writer, BaseColor colorSpace, float coords, float domain, PdfFunction function, bool extend ) : PdfShading
writer PdfWriter
colorSpace iTextSharp.text.BaseColor
coords float
domain float
function PdfFunction
extend bool
Результат PdfShading

Type3() публичный статический метод

public static Type3 ( PdfWriter writer, BaseColor colorSpace, float coords, float domain, PdfFunction function, bool extend ) : PdfShading
writer PdfWriter
colorSpace iTextSharp.text.BaseColor
coords float
domain float
function PdfFunction
extend bool
Результат PdfShading

Описание свойств

antiAlias защищенное свойство

protected bool antiAlias
Результат bool

bBox защищенное свойство

protected float[] bBox
Результат float[]

colorDetails защищенное свойство

protected ColorDetails,iTextSharp.text.pdf colorDetails
Результат ColorDetails

shading защищенное свойство

protected PdfDictionary,iTextSharp.text.pdf shading
Результат PdfDictionary

shadingName защищенное свойство

protected PdfName,iTextSharp.text.pdf shadingName
Результат PdfName

shadingReference защищенное свойство

protected PdfIndirectReference,iTextSharp.text.pdf shadingReference
Результат PdfIndirectReference

shadingType защищенное свойство

protected int shadingType
Результат int

writer защищенное свойство

protected PdfWriter,iTextSharp.text.pdf writer
Результат PdfWriter